Transforming Curriculum for A Culturally Diverse Society
Unlock the potential of a culturally inclusive education with "Transforming Curriculum for A Culturally Diverse Society" by Taylor & Francis Inc. Published in 1996, this insightful paperback spans 312 pages, expertly guiding educators on how to reshape public school curricula to better reflect and embrace the rich tapestry of cultural diversity in America.
Through thoughtful debate, deliberation, and collaboration, this book encourages the engagement of diverse voices in the educational process. It offers practical strategies and innovative ideas that foster an inclusive environment, ensuring that all students feel valued and represented.
